Abstract

(57)【要約】 第1:負圧を生じ、中心静脈への穿剌の際に血液を吸引し、穿剌を自動的に確認する、ベロ−付きバル−ンを有する。第2:血液の流出を避けて、カテ−テルの迅速な初期の導入を可能にする自動引き金を有する。若干の血液が流出する場合、血液はプラスチックバル−ン内に留められるので、使用者は汚染されない。第3:迅速取付フックは安全で、しかも従来品を使用する場合に通常行われる患者への縫合糸による縫付けを不要とする。 (57) [Summary] No. 1: It has a bellowed balloon that generates negative pressure, draws blood when puncturing the central vein, and automatically confirms puncturing. Second: having an automatic trigger that allows for a rapid initial introduction of the catheter, avoiding blood spills. If some blood escapes, the user will not be contaminated since the blood will remain in the plastic balloon. Third: the quick attach hook is safe and eliminates the need for suture suturing to the patient, which is usually done when using conventional products.

This tube is plastic Used in place of box 14.   In practice, the procedure for catheter insertion into the central vein using this device is as follows. This is done: First: Hold down the bellows balloon 9 and hold the device with the grip 10 of the guide piercing needle base. Hold and insert the guide piercing needle into the patient's skin and release the bellowed balloon. Thereby, a negative pressure, that is, a suction force is generated. Second: When piercing the central vein, blood passes through the guide piercing needle due to the action of the suction force. To reach the balloon, indicating that the vein was pierced. Third: Withdraw the flexible conduit 1 to the central vein with the finger of the other hand while pulling out the guiding piercing needle. Introduce. Fourth: The catheter 5 is compressed like a spring in the tubular plastic balloon 12 Therefore, when the guiding piercing needle 2 is completely withdrawn, it is introduced into the opening of the flexible conduit 1. It will be in a state that can be done. Fifth: Hold the outside of the catheter 5 and push it with your finger to plastically Introduce through the balloon. At this time, make sure that there is no blood You. Sixth: Withdrawing the conduit from the patient's body and holding the conduit bases 6, 7 firmly Split the conduit along two grooves to separate them and discard the conduit. Seventh: Fix the attachment hook to the patient's skin, close the pressure cover, and attach the tip of the hook. Protect. Fix the catheter to the non-slip clip 21 and finally in the catheter 5 The steel rod is removed from the and bound to the drug serum.
